> In an effort to form a stable WMIN working environment and utilize the
> community’s experience in terms of guidance, the EC, has decided to form an
*Advisory
> Committee Board*. Since the past EC was already working on it, as a new
> EC, it’s our duty to take it forward.
>
> Since, we want to include all the domains of work that are associated
> with the working of WMIN, we propose different verticals under which the
> advisory committee would advise the EC -
>
> - Law,
> - Organizational Development,
> - Technology,
> - Policy making,
> - Outreach and
> - Others (Open to suggestions from the community)
>
> The function of the Advisory committee board will be to advise the
> Wikimedia India chapter EC in its strategic decision-making process. They
> will be providing the EC with appropriate suggestions and solutions towards
> queries and solicitations specifically asked for.
>
> It shall not be a part of the final decisions and resolutions adopted by
> the Board. In general, the Advisory Committee members may remain for an
> indefinite term.
